Question

How to trade on nymex?

To place a trade on Nymex to purchase a commodities / futures contract you would contact your broker. For investors in the United States your broker would need to be registered with the National Futures Association and most likely will have their series 3 license. If you do not have a broker you can view a listing of brokers under the referenced link below. Normally, finding the best possible price is what your broker is looking to do when executing a trade on your behalf. If you decide you want to ensure your trade is executed on Nymex then ask your broker if they can manually enter the trade so as to ensure it is routed to this specific exchange.
